<span>Dealing with finances becomes more difficult when working on a commission basis because unlike working on a salary basis, there is no regular pay. A commission means that earnings are based on rate of sale or number of completed tasks. Income may be reduced if you do not sell enough, or fail to complete enough tasks.</span>
